Transaction 5037605646e65526822f1e11ae90c23c31f660a4f70ed11b5bcf978545144612

1 Input
2 Outputs
  • 5037605646e65526822f1e11ae90c23c31f660a4f70ed11b5bcf978545144612:0
  • value  3199834
    address  2Mz3dHXyvypYsZUStjS3dDoXM4oGAgoezhy
  • 5037605646e65526822f1e11ae90c23c31f660a4f70ed11b5bcf978545144612:1
  • value  1000000
    address  2MsT2rVRh3WiRUMRNvvW3bpsHjGVCSHTn7R